Text & Tech Lunch Panel Member: Otis White
Otis White
Otis holds a BA in Human Resources and an MBA in International Business as well as numerous credit hours in psychology (studying cognitive learning processes and statistics, and teaching research methods lab courses). Since 1993, coming to Rio Salado as a counselor in the Small Business Development center, Otis has taught over 170 semester hours across 23 courses from the business curriculum including sections from the GBS, MGT, IBS, SBS, and TQM areas. In addition he teaches the capstone course (Entrepreneurship and Small Business Management) for graduating seniors at the Polytechnic campus of ASU in the Business Administration Program. Otis has also started three companies over the years. His early business background was in advertising and marketing and later he moved on to consulting and corporate education. Otis has worked in the corporate education and consulting fields for the past 20 years.
